Delta Medical College Bangladesh Admission Process

Delta Medical College follows BMDC, DGHS, and University of Dhaka guidelines. Indian students must qualify for NEET and meet the minimum PCB percentage requirements.

Eligibility Criteria:

  • Minimum age: Usually 17 years

  • 10+2/HSC with Physics, Chemistry, Biology (minimum aggregate marks as per current BMDC rules)

  • NEET qualification mandatory for Indian students

  • Valid passport and other documents for foreign applicants

Application Process:

  • Apply directly or through authorized representatives/consultants

  • Submit academic transcripts, NEET scorecard (for Indians), passport, and required documents

  • Meet eligibility and appear for any necessary processes as per annual BMDC circular

  • Pay initial fees to confirm seat after document verification

  • Classes generally align with the annual intake

Delta Medical College Bangladesh Scholarships 2026

Merit, need-based & government scholarships available at Delta Medical College. Check your eligibility now.

πŸŽ“ Merit-BasedπŸ’° Need-BasedπŸ›οΈ Govt. ScholarshipπŸ”¬ Research Fellowship

Scholarships at Delta Medical College are quite limited, especially for international and Indian students. The college primarily follows merit-based and government-regulated support systems rather than offering generous financial aid packages. Most foreign students study under the self-financed category.

Detailed Scholarship & Financial Support Options:

  • Merit-Based Scholarships / Fee Waivers: Offered to top-performing students based on outstanding results in 10+2 examinations or internal university professional exams. High NEET scorers or academically excellent students may receive partial tuition reductions. These are decided by the college management and are highly competitive.

  • Trust / Management Quota Concessions: The Dhaka Community Hospital Trust occasionally provides limited fee concessions or one-time incentives to deserving candidates. Priority is often given to students with consistent academic records and early applications.

  • Performance-Based Incentives During Course: Students who maintain excellent results in the professional examinations (1st, 2nd, 3rd & Final Professional) may get tuition fee discounts in subsequent years or special recognition from the college.

  • Government / Quota Seats: A very small number of seats may fall under government or trust quotas with possible fee benefits, but these are mostly for local Bangladeshi students and extremely competitive.
